For those who thought yesterday would be toughest day, (and I was one of them), they were wrong. Today was equally painful.
Stats – Roncesvalles to Lubiri – 15.26 miles, burned 1248 calories. Departed 10:25 am, arrived 6:05 pm. Late start because we wanted a map and stamp on our pilgrim passports from the pilgrim office.


We took several breaks as the elevation changed often and the terrain was something out of the ice age in many places.



I learned today that I needed to adjust my backpack up higher. Never having worn before, I was clueless. Once adjusted, my back wasn’t screaming so much.
